Usage notes
* We speak of a thing as correct' with reference to some rule or standard of comparison; as, a '''correct''' account, a '''correct''' likeness, a man of ' correct deportment. * We speak of a thing as accurate' with reference to the care bestowed upon its execution, and the increased correctness to be expected therefrom; as, an '''accurate''' statement, an ' accurate detail of particulars. * We speak of a thing as exact' with reference to that perfected state of a thing in which there is no defect and no redundancy; as, an '''exact''' coincidence, the '''exact''' truth, an ' exact likeness. * We speak of a thing as precise' when we think of it as strictly conformed to some rule or model, as if ''cut down'' thereto; as a '''precise''' conformity instructions; '''precisely''' right; he was very ' precise in giving his directions.Synonyms
